What is a Safety Critical Medical?
A Safety Critical medical is an occupational medical assessment of an individual where their health status may compromise their ability to undertake a task defined as safety critical, thereby posing a significant risk to the health and safety of others.

Health Surveillance Audiometry Testing for a Joinery Company based in Wiltshire
A joinery company contacted us after a visit from the HSE. They were falling short on health surveillance for their employees, in particular in relation to noise exposure at work over the 2nd Action level of 85dBA. Here’s how we helped with their audiometry health surveillance hearing tests.

Legal Requirements of Occupational Health
Health surveillance allows for early identification of ill health and helps identify any corrective action needed. It may also be required by law for employees exposed to noise/vibration, solvents, fumes, dust, biological agents or work in compressed air.
